Answer -
Well first of all, I would contact the towing company with estimates via certified mail.  If that does not work then your best bet is small claims court.

Sorry to hear that damages happened to your vehicle, but just like accidents happen it does from time to time.  
I am not sure what was exactly damaged during the tow so its hard to say if they repaired it or not or even correctly.  They did try at least to start to solve the problem, but it might of been over their abilities to repair it.
